v. (动词)
  1. complain的基本意思是“抱怨”“诉苦”。指心中对人或事物不满或身体感到不适或痛苦而对别人诉说或抱怨,有时也可表示说话者引起别人对此事的注意。
  2. 用作不及物动词时,其后可接of或about引起的短语, of后常是诉苦的内容,可为名词或动名词,而about后则是对抱怨事物概括的陈述。当表示“向…抱怨…”时,要用complain to sb of〔about〕 sth 结构。
  3. complain用作及物动词时,可接that从句,但不能接动词不定式。
  4. complain还有“申诉”“投诉”的意思,其后可接about, of或against。
  5. complain可用于进行时,这时除表示“正在抱怨”外,多表示一种感情色彩或个人情绪。
v. (动词)
complain, grumble, murmur
  • 这组词的共同意思是“抱怨”或“埋怨”。其区别是:
  • 1.complain是向别人诉苦; murmur是背着别人自言自语地“抱怨”; grumble通常带有感情色彩和个人情绪,指一边发脾气,一边自己对自己叽叽咕咕。
  • 2.complain还有“投诉”的意思。
  • 3.grumble多用于指男性。
  • complain,grumble,murmur
  • 这些动词均含“抱怨、埋怨”之意。
  • complain侧重因对处境不满、待遇不公或自己有痛苦等而向别人诉说、埋怨。
  • grumble指因对处境、待遇不满或其他个人因素而愤愤不平地向他人诉苦或自言自语。
  • murmur多指因不满某人或某事而背着人自言自语地发怨言。
  • 词源解说

    • ☆ 1370年左右进入英语,直接源自古法语的complaindre,意为为……哀悼;最初源自古典拉丁语的complangere:com (更强地) + plangere (打,拍打胸脯),意为猛烈地拍打胸脯。
    用作动词 (v.)
    complain about (v.+prep.)
      抱怨,投诉 express an unfavourable opinion about
      complain about sth/v-ing

      I wish to complain about the washing machine that I bought last month; it stopped working again.

      我上个月买的那台洗衣机不能用了,我可要投诉它质量不佳了。

      He never complained about working overtime.

      他从来不因加班而抱怨。

      The food was complained about to the nurse.

      (人们)向护士投诉了伙食不好。

    complain against (v.+prep.)
      (向…)申诉 say (sth) is wrong to (sb)
      complain against sb/sth

      I have to complain against him because of his rudeness.

      我不得不申诉他的无礼。

      She have to complain against the slight injuries.

      她不得不诉说这小伤害。

    complain of (v.+prep.)
      抱怨,诉苦 say that (sth) is wrong; find fault
      complain of sth/v-ing

      He complained of being underpaid.

      他抱怨工资太低。

      She complained to me of his rudeness.

      她向我抱怨了他的粗鲁。

      Go to the teacher and complain of needing more time to do the work.

      去找老师诉诉苦,就说做作业的时间不够。

      He often complains of his memory.

      他常抱怨自己的记性不好。

      I've got nothing to complain of really.

      我真的没有什么可抱怨的。

      Mother is always complaining of not having enough time.

      母亲总是抱怨没有足够的时间。

    complain to (v.+prep.)
      向…抱怨 say that sth is wrong to sb
      complain to sb

      You'll have to complain to Head Office if the washing machine stops working again.

      要是洗衣机再出毛病的话,你只好向总公司诉说了。

      Complain to the boy's mother, not to me.

      找孩子他妈说去,别找我。

      complain to sb that-clause

      Mrs. Jones complained to the doctor that her back always hurts her.

      琼斯太太向医生诉说她背部老是痛。

      She complained to me that he had been rude to her.

      她向我诉说他曾对她有粗鲁的行为。
